If you would like a successful business, then it is important that you understand how your image is reflective to your overall success. Managing your reputation in an unprofessional way can sink your business faster than you would believe possible. Check out the tips below to help you overcome the hurdles of reputation management.

Always protect and improve your business reputation by following up with all your customers. This is even more important if your business is large. Customers deserve to feel they are important to you. Try using a system that's automated and can work with a customer. Also, get their feedback on purchases.

Be friendly and sociable online. You can't just post status updates or tweets without interacting with followers. If you receive a question on a social media site, be sure to respond immediately. If you are not sure of the answer, let them know that you will find out and let them know.

Big search engines, such as Google, favor authoritativeness. When you're viewed as an authority, the search engines may raise your site in the search results.

If you do a search for your company online and you see information that is not true, you can petition the site owner and ask them to take it down. As long as you can show solid proof that this information is libelous, most site owners will have no problems removing it.

If you own a business, always respect employees. If you don't, it will come back to harm you in the end. No one wants to patronize a bad employer.

Make sure to monitor all social networking sites. Companies are discussed on these sites frequently. Monitoring the platforms enables you to do immediate damage control on any negative comments posted. This is a good way to help your business's reputation get protected from damage.

When you see something negative in print about your company, it's natural to get angry at the person who wrote the comment, especially if what they commented on wasn't completely truthful. But, it is far better to gather yourself and respond honestly with facts that tend to vindicate your position. When people read what both of you have said, they can come to their own conclusions.

Get into sponsoring an event in a community as a corporate entity. This can help improve the reputation of your company. It's a positive way to reach out to new and old customers alike. And that can make a lot of difference when it comes time to buy.
